基于区间直觉模糊数的得分函数与精确函数及其应用

摘    要:在模糊决策理论中,区间直觉模糊数的排序是一个非常重要的理论问题.运用得分函数和精确函数对区间直觉模糊数进行有效排序的关键是得分函数和精确函数的科学构建.本文基于得分函数和精确函数的内涵,运用概率论全概率公式思想提出了新的得分函数和精确函数,并证明了其公理化的性质.通过大量的实际数据测算与比较分析,验证了本文提出的得分函数和精确函数的科学性,从而在对区间直觉模糊数排序时更有效、更准确.

A new score function and accuracy function of interval-valued intuitionistic fuzzy number and its application

Abstract:In fuzzy decision theory, the ranking of interval valued intuitionistic fuzzy numbers is a very important theoretical problem. The key of using the score function and the exact function to rank the interval intuitionistic fuzzy numbers is the scientific construction of the scoring function and the exact function. Based on the connotation of scoring function and exact function, the new scoring function and exact function are put forward by using the idea of probability theory and total probability formula, and its axiomatic properties are proved. Through a large number of actual data calculation and comparative analysis, the scoring function and the exact function proposed in this paper are more scientific and more effective and accurate in ranking the interval fuzzy numbers.
